As far as I know, this is the only established lore regarding the flag symbols: Ok, it has been bugging me for two months now, but what is that symbol on the top of the Clan Javat flag? It looks like a mathematical symbol above a J A V. I've tried looking for it through Wikpedia but I can find nothing similar to it. Is it an engineering symbol or something made up? Also, what is the Steel Song Clan symbol supposed to represent? I have imagined it to be a seashell, a steel coin, or possibly a gear; but I have no solid idea. Do the different Factions have nicknames for themselves and each other? that is the astrological symbol of Libra. The star's edge introduction originally states that the sector of space is "beyond the constellations of Libra" which is the reason that I used that symbol. It looks cool and unlike Scorpio, doesn't appear to be a letter but is a symbol pure (like the astrological symbol which is the only one not representing an animal, person or insect.) The Steel Song flag is a chakra wheel, a reference to there belief in the etherial spirit of man, and the cycle of rebirth. Steel Song Assassins are not killing anyone -- they're giving them a chance to be reincarnated in better lives -- Steel Song lives, if they're pure enough. haven't gotten so far to come up with Faction specific slurs against other factions, but that's a clever idea and something that would happen for sure =)
